<div class='os_post_top_link'><a href='http://www.opennetcf.org/sdf2' target='_blank'>http://www.opennetcf.org/sdf2</a><br /><br /></div><i>"We're pleased to announce the Release of the Smart Device Framework (SDF) 2.0 Extensions for Visual Studio. SDF 2.0 is a continuation of our version 1.4 efforts to improve the development experience for Smart Device developers using the Microsoft .NET Compact Framework. SDF 2.0 has a significant number of changes, improvements and enhancement over the previous versions. The compiled binaries for SDF 2.0 are freely downloadable and distributable. The SDF 2.0 Extensions for Visual Studio are an affordable set of plug ins for Visual Studio 2005. They provide full intellisense and designer support for all SDF 2.0 libraries, plus they come with full source code for the entire SDF 2.0."</i><br /><br /> <img src="http://www.smartphonethoughts.com/images/Temporale-SmartDeviceFramework.png" alt="User submitted image" title="User submitted image"/> <br /><br />The guys over at OpenNetCF have done it again.
